James Steensma's voice has captivated many first-time listeners. Hailing from Northeast Indiana, Steensma is, however, no new face to the music scene. In 1989, he appeared off-Broadway in the musical "One Voice." He has appeared in over 30 musical and theatrical productions throughout the Midwest, garnering 3 Anthony Award nominations (Ft. Wayne Theatre Awards) for acting in the early 1990's.
He left the theatre in the mid-90's to focus on his music and family. Having performed with several quartets, and as a member of a popular duo, Steensma has sung in front of multiple thousands of people. In 1994, he was the opening act at a concert for the Christian recording group AVB. He has been a featured soloist in churches and cathedrals, musical halls and theaters. He has also been the featured soloist at local observances of the National Day of Prayer, Earth Day, and Habitat for Humanity's dedication ceremonies.
In 1989, Steensma recorded the haunting "David's Song" for the official "One Voice" soundtrack. And now comes his solo debut CD, "...Even in the Quietest Moments."
This intimate album of faith - with piano, guitar and voice alone - features four songs written by Keith Green, and includes covers of songs made popular by Carolyn Arends, Donny Osmond, Marc Cohn, the Bee Gees, and others. Along with those eight tracks, you'll find two original numbers written by Steensma for this project: "Even in the Quietest Moments" and "The Last Twenty Years."
The first release from the CD, "Even in the Quietest Moments", received radio airplay on stations in Northeast Indiana, and on the internet.
In 2003, Steensma recorded "Solo El Amor" with Jaime Shoup for her CD "You Give Me Wings To Fly." Jaime duets with James on "In This Moment" for Steensma's project.
